the front mounts hold the bearing, and more than likely will come apart during replacement, so plan on replacements. The rears should be done, especially if the car is making that strange knocking sound on bumps, plan on replacements.
The fronts can actually be done with the strut assembly in the car, it comes right out the top. The rears dont have springs on them, because of the leaf spring.
You will need to rent the autozone tool to get the fronts out.

seems as though thats a generic picture. That is actually a front assembly pictured for the rear. The rear is a cartridge and a mount. No spring.
Fronts need to have the springs swapped over, or you can replace them with the car on the ground by using the gm strut removal tool.
